Transaction d8c17da6800c19de7c79840827a269e783ba4844e0445072f791d3e56a1142ee
1 Input
1 Output
-
d8c17da6800c19de7c79840827a269e783ba4844e0445072f791d3e56a1142ee:0
- value
- 2367962
- script pubkey
- OP_0 OP_PUSHBYTES_20 57aa03376c67f0143fbe9b9767d565687e24b520
- address
- bc1q274qxdmvvlcpg0a7nwtk04t9dplzfdfqqvmd0f